One of the most common questions for anyone new to Lagos or trying to navigate its complex geography is understanding which areas fall on the bustling Island and which are part of the expansive Mainland. Today, we're setting the record straight on a well-known locality: Iponri. So, is Iponri on the Island or Mainland?
Let's get straight to it: **Iponri is firmly located on the Lagos Mainland.** It's a vibrant and strategically important area within the Surulere Local Government Area (LGA), known for its historical significance, commercial activities, and its role as a key transport hub connecting different parts of Lagos.

Iponri is situated in the heart of the Lagos Mainland, specifically within the **Surulere Local Government Area (LGA)**. Surulere itself is one of the most populated and economically active LGAs in Lagos State, known for its residential estates, commercial centres, and entertainment spots.

The general terrain of Iponri, like much of the Lagos Mainland, is relatively flat, making it suitable for extensive road networks and infrastructure development. Its proximity to major bridges that link the Mainland to the Island (like Eko Bridge and Carter Bridge via Ebute Metta) further solidifies its importance as a gateway between the two distinct parts of Lagos.

Navigating Lagos transport requires an understanding of fare ranges, as prices can fluctuate based on traffic, time of day, and fuel costs. Below is a table of estimated fare ranges for popular routes to and from Iponri in 2026. Remember, these are estimates, and it's always wise to confirm with the driver before boarding.
| Route | Transport Mode | Fare Range (β¦) |
|---|---|---|
| Iponri to Yaba | Commercial Bus (Danfo), Keke Napep | β¦200 - β¦400 |
| Iponri to Costain | Commercial Bus (Danfo), Keke Napep | β¦150 - β¦300 |
| Iponri to Ojuelegba | Commercial Bus (Danfo), Keke Napep | β¦250 - β¦500 |
| Iponri to CMS/Marina (Lagos Island) | Commercial Bus (Danfo) | β¦400 - β¦800 |
| Iponri to Oshodi | Commercial Bus (Danfo) | β¦400 - β¦700 |
| Iponri to Apapa | Commercial Bus (Danfo) | β¦300 - β¦600 |
| Iponri to Ikeja | Commercial Bus (Danfo) (often via Ojuelegba/Fadeyi) | β¦500 - β¦1,000 |

A: To get to Lagos Island from Iponri, you can take a commercial bus (Danfo) from Iponri or Costain heading towards CMS, Marina, or Tafawa Balewa Square (TBS). These buses typically cross the Eko Bridge.
A: Iponri is generally considered a busy, relatively safe commercial and residential area. Like any urban center, it's important to be vigilant, especially in crowded places and during late hours. Using common sense and avoiding isolated areas at night is always recommended.
A: Iponri is well-served by various public transport options. You'll find commercial buses (Danfo) for longer routes, Keke Napep (tricycles) for shorter distances within Surulere, and motorcycle taxis (Okada) are also available, though their routes might be restricted on major roads. Ride-hailing services are also readily available.
